Den Ouden Bodac is commissioned by the muncipality of Albasserdam to start with the preperations for the storage of a hawker typhoon- fighter aircraft that crashed in the polder Krotland in Albasserdam during world war two. The storing of the wreck starts on the 26th of Febuary and will take approximately two weeks.

Civil engineering support 

The plane wreck is in the soil under a quite accesible forrest- and walking area. Because of the possible pressence of remainders of ammunation, weapens and flueds, the municipality asked defence to store the wreck and remove possible ammunation. Den Ouden Bodac offers with this civil technical support and takes care of the remediation of possible contaminated ground. Den Ouden Bodac is one of the few company's in the Netherlands that are specialised in carrying out aircraft salvage operations.

Safe and clean soil 

Next to ammunation and other remains of weapens, according to research there is jet fuel present in the soil around the plane. The presence of the wreck forms a health and safety risk for people, flora and fauna in the area 

With the storing of the plane wreck Den Ouden Bodac makes the soil safe again for people and the environment.
